How this is worked out

  1. Take both airports' published coordinates from OurAirports — nothing here is scraped from another flight site.
  2. Great-circle distance by haversine on a mean earth radius of 6,371.0088 km: 13,070 km.
  3. Airborne time = that distance ÷ 805 km/h, a representative jet cruise speed: 16h 14m.
  4. Add a flat 25 minutes for pushback, taxi, climb, descent and taxi-in — the reason a 400 km hop is never half an hour: 16h 39m gate to gate.
  5. Winds, aircraft type and airline schedule padding are not modelled. The cruise-speed table shows how much that assumption is worth.
13,070 km / 805 km/h = 16h 14m airborne
            + 25 min ground = 16h 39m gate to gate

Flight time at different cruise speeds

Aircraft type, winds and routing all move the real number. This is the same distance flown at different speeds, plus the 25-minute ground and climb allowance.

Typical ofCruise speedAirborneGate to gate
Turboprop / regional550 km/h23h 46m24h 11m
Narrowbody jet (A320, 737)780 km/h16h 45m17h 11m
Widebody jet (777, 787, A350)900 km/h14h 31m14h 57m
Private jet (Gulfstream)850 km/h15h 23m15h 48m

Headwinds on an eastbound long-haul routinely add 30–60 minutes; the same route westbound can be quicker. Airlines publish schedules with padding built in.

Questions this plate answers

How long is the flight from Chicago to Manila (Pasay)?

A non-stop flight from Chicago (ORD) to Manila (Pasay) (MNL) takes about 16h 39m. The great-circle distance is 13,070 km (8,121 miles, 7,057 nautical miles), flying north-west on an initial bearing of 328°.

How far is Chicago from Manila (Pasay)?

13,070 kilometres in a straight line over the earth's surface — 8,121 miles or 7,057 nautical miles. Actual flown distance is usually 2–5% longer because aircraft follow airways, avoid weather and route around restricted airspace.

Is there a non-stop flight between ORD and MNL?

This page calculates the direct-line time and distance; it does not track airline schedules. At 13,070 km the route is within reach of long-range widebodies, though not every city pair is served non-stop. Check an airline or booking site for what is actually scheduled.

What should I expect on a 16h 39m flight?

Anything past six hours is a long-haul flight: expect at least one meal service, a significant time-zone shift, and enough sitting that circulation and hydration start to matter. Cabin altitude, dry air and disrupted sleep do more damage to a training routine than the flight itself.
